Set in Jukkasjärvi on the banks of the Torne (the border river separating Sweden from Finland), this was the first ice hotel ever built, with rooms hovering around -5°C and striking ice sculptures that are created afresh every year.
2. The Dog Bark Park Inn, Cottonwood, United States
Dreamt up and built by two sculptors, the Dog Bark Park Inn is a dog-shaped hotel in Cottonwood, Idaho, in the United States. It has only two large rooms, and they come at quite a price.
3. No Man's Fort, England
An English fort dating from the Victorian era was renovated and turned into a 5-star venue complete with a spa, a helipad and even a cabaret. A place perfectly suited to events such as weddings or conferences.
4. Giraffe Manor, Kenya
This is an African manor house with European architecture, where guests are kept company throughout their stay by beautiful, inquisitive giraffes. Every year it welcomes visitors from all over the world in search of a magical experience that delights young and old alike.
5. Taj Lake Palace, India
A legendary hotel. A true jewel on the water, the Taj Lake Palace is a white marble palace that seems to float on the lake, a tribute to the maharanas of Udaipur. The hotel uses a boat to bring guests across from a jetty.
6. Erg Chigaga Luxury Desert Camp, Morocco
To experience the magic of the desert and warm yourself in the hospitality of the Tuareg nomads in Morocco, there is only one address: the Erg Chigaga Luxury Desert Camp. A few kilometres from M'hammid El Ghizlane, this high-end hotel is surrounded by sand dunes. It offers permanent tents deep in the desert, local cuisine and a range of activities to delight adventurers.
